Urgent AD of the Day

FAA NPRM (Jan 2026): 737NG Stabilizer Pivot Hinge Inspection — Proposed mandatory inspection of 737NG horizontal stabilizer pivot hinges and jackscrew for excessive free play — flutter risk. Affects all US-registered 737NG variants (~1,987 aircraft). Currently in comment period, not yet final.

Question of the Day

During a flight control cable inspection, what is generally used to check for correct cable tension rather than relying on “feel” alone? (A) A spring-scale tensiometer (B) A dial torque wrench (C) A vernier caliper — Answer: A
